Tente executar um utilitário como Sharepoint Manager em seu site. Talvez ele veja uma lista chamada Páginas que, por algum motivo, você não está vendo na interface da Web.
Estou tendo problemas com um conjunto de sites em um farm MOSS2007. Estou tentando ativar o recurso de publicação no nível do conjunto de sites. Quando tento ativar o recurso de configurações do site - > recursos do conjunto de sites, recebo uma dessas mensagens de erro do SharePoint incrivelmente úteis.
Error. Cannot complete this action. Please try again.
Então eu pensei em tentar com o stsadm, e eu corri isto
stsadm -o activatefeature -name Publishing -url http://server/site
Recebi a mensagem de erro mais útil
Provisioning did not succeed. Details: Failed to create the 'Pages' library. OriginalException: The feature failed to activate because a list at 'Pages' already exists in this site. Delete or rename the list and try activating the feature again.
Agora, é mais parecido com isso! Eu verifiquei, e com certeza havia uma biblioteca de páginas. Eu deletei. Eu corri stsadm novamente esperando que funcionasse desta vez. Sem dados. Estou recebendo o mesmo erro, mas agora não há biblioteca de documentos 'Páginas'. Eu esvaziei a lixeira. Mesmo erro. Estou perplexo.
De acordo com as duas sugestões abaixo, certifiquei-me de que a lixeira de reciclar do conjunto de sites também estivesse vazia e de que não havia bibliotecas de "Imagens" ou "Documentos" por perto. Ainda não consigo ativar o recurso.
Tente executar um utilitário como Sharepoint Manager em seu site. Talvez ele veja uma lista chamada Páginas que, por algum motivo, você não está vendo na interface da Web.
Os recursos de publicação cria três bibliotecas (entre outras coisas)
Pode ser necessário excluir mais do que apenas a biblioteca de páginas.
às vezes, lista, web ou página já existe enquanto você está executando o código de provisionamento você pode usar o designer do ponto de compartilhamento para marcar esse objeto e excluí-lo de lá
Felicidades